Enable Resourcing is seeking an experienced Senior Quantity Surveyor to join their team in Maidstone, UK. This role will be primarily site-based, ensuring effective management of project finances and risks in civil engineering projects. The ideal candidate should have at least 10 years of commercial experience and a degree in Quantity Surveying.
Responsibilities include:
- Financial reporting
- Contractual management
- Client liaison
- Budget overseeing
The position supports a dynamic environment with significant project scale, contributing to both public and private sector projects.
